1. Understanding Disability Services:

Disability services encompass a wide range of support systems, programs, and resources designed to empower individuals with disabilities to lead fulfilling lives and participate fully in their communities. These services may include assistance with daily living activities, access to specialized healthcare, education and employment support, recreational programs, and advocacy services.

5. Accessible Transportation:

Transportation plays a vital role in ensuring mobility and independence for individuals with disabilities service In Pakenham, accessible transportation options are available to facilitate travel within the suburb and beyond. Public transportation services offer wheelchair-accessible buses, designated seating areas, and assistance for passengers with mobility challenges. Additionally, community transport services provide door-to-door transportation for individuals unable to use conventional public transportation due to disability-related barriers.
